Stacking Benjamin’s. Three episodes a week. I may catch one a
Week. Each episode starts with two news stories and they discuss them. Then they have a guest each week, and close out with some Q&A from listeners. The two co-hosts cut up a lot, I typically find myself laughing throughout the show.

It kind of reminds me the car talk show on NPR, except they are talking finance vs cars.
